8 WOODBERRY DRIVE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Birmingham local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 8 WOODBERRY DRIVE sales between February 1998 and May 2017 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2004 sale was for 39%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 39% above the HPI over time, until the May 2017 sale, where it falls to 15%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 15% above the HPI.

What might 8 WOODBERRY DRIVE be worth now?

8 WOODBERRY DRIVE might now be worth an estimated £247,136.

This is based on house price inflation of 45.4%, between May 2017 and June 2025, for terraced houses, in the Birmingham local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 45.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 8 WOODBERRY DRIVE of £169,995 on 24th May 2017. For the value to have increased from £169,995 to £247,136 over the seven years and eleven months to June 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 8 WOODBERRY DRIVE has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the Birmingham local authority area.
  • The May 2017 sale price of £169,995 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 8 WOODBERRY DRIVE has not materially changed since May 2017.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
